While fishing along the ICW this afternoon, I saw a floating cabin under tow by 3 game warden boats. One was escorting, and one was on either side of the cabin pushing/towing it north towards the JFK bridge. Never seen that before.

No fish for me...one hardhead for friend....slow fishing, saw no real bait nor working birds, even tried along Packery channel.....but a beautiful day.

There is an article in a recent CCA publication stating CCA has donated funds to rehab the TXP&WL floating cabin on Baffin, so what you saw might have been the referenced cabin being taken in for the rehab.
